org.apache.hadoop.yarn.api.records.impl.pb
Class ApplicationMasterPBImpl

java.lang.Object
  extended by org.apache.hadoop.yarn.api.records.ProtoBase<YarnProtos.ApplicationMasterProto>
      extended by org.apache.hadoop.yarn.api.records.impl.pb.ApplicationMasterPBImpl
All Implemented Interfaces:
ApplicationMaster

public class ApplicationMasterPBImpl
extends ProtoBase<YarnProtos.ApplicationMasterProto>
implements ApplicationMaster


Constructor Summary
ApplicationMasterPBImpl()
           
ApplicationMasterPBImpl(YarnProtos.ApplicationMasterProto proto)
           
 
Method Summary
 int getAMFailCount()
           
 ApplicationId getApplicationId()
           
 String getClientToken()
           
 int getContainerCount()
           
 String getDiagnostics()
           
 String getHost()
           
 YarnProtos.ApplicationMasterProto getProto()
           
 int getRpcPort()
           
 YarnApplicationState getState()
           
 ApplicationStatus getStatus()
           
 String getTrackingUrl()
           
 void setAMFailCount(int amFailCount)
           
 void setApplicationId(ApplicationId applicationId)
           
 void setClientToken(String clientToken)
           
 void setContainerCount(int containerCount)
           
 void setDiagnostics(String diagnostics)
           
 void setHost(String host)
           
 void setRpcPort(int rpcPort)
           
 void setState(YarnApplicationState state)
           
 void setStatus(ApplicationStatus status)
           
 void setTrackingUrl(String url)
           
 
Methods inherited from class org.apache.hadoop.yarn.api.records.ProtoBase
convertFromProtoFormat, convertToProtoFormat, equals, hashCode, toString
 
Methods inherited from class java.lang.Object
clone, finalize, getClass, notify, notifyAll, wait, wait, wait
 

Constructor Detail

ApplicationMasterPBImpl

public ApplicationMasterPBImpl()

ApplicationMasterPBImpl

public ApplicationMasterPBImpl(YarnProtos.ApplicationMasterProto proto)
Method Detail

getProto

public YarnProtos.ApplicationMasterProto getProto()
Specified by:
getProto in class ProtoBase<YarnProtos.ApplicationMasterProto>

getState

public YarnApplicationState getState()
Specified by:
getState in interface ApplicationMaster

setState

public void setState(YarnApplicationState state)
Specified by:
setState in interface ApplicationMaster

getHost

public String getHost()
Specified by:
getHost in interface ApplicationMaster

setHost

public void setHost(String host)
Specified by:
setHost in interface ApplicationMaster

getApplicationId

public ApplicationId getApplicationId()
Specified by:
getApplicationId in interface ApplicationMaster

setApplicationId

public void setApplicationId(ApplicationId applicationId)
Specified by:
setApplicationId in interface ApplicationMaster

getRpcPort

public int getRpcPort()
Specified by:
getRpcPort in interface ApplicationMaster

setRpcPort

public void setRpcPort(int rpcPort)
Specified by:
setRpcPort in interface ApplicationMaster

getTrackingUrl

public String getTrackingUrl()
Specified by:
getTrackingUrl in interface ApplicationMaster

setTrackingUrl

public void setTrackingUrl(String url)
Specified by:
setTrackingUrl in interface ApplicationMaster

getStatus

public ApplicationStatus getStatus()
Specified by:
getStatus in interface ApplicationMaster

setStatus

public void setStatus(ApplicationStatus status)
Specified by:
setStatus in interface ApplicationMaster

getClientToken

public String getClientToken()
Specified by:
getClientToken in interface ApplicationMaster

setClientToken

public void setClientToken(String clientToken)
Specified by:
setClientToken in interface ApplicationMaster

getAMFailCount

public int getAMFailCount()
Specified by:
getAMFailCount in interface ApplicationMaster

getContainerCount

public int getContainerCount()
Specified by:
getContainerCount in interface ApplicationMaster

setAMFailCount

public void setAMFailCount(int amFailCount)
Specified by:
setAMFailCount in interface ApplicationMaster

setContainerCount

public void setContainerCount(int containerCount)
Specified by:
setContainerCount in interface ApplicationMaster

getDiagnostics

public String getDiagnostics()
Specified by:
getDiagnostics in interface ApplicationMaster

setDiagnostics

public void setDiagnostics(String diagnostics)
Specified by:
setDiagnostics in interface ApplicationMaster


Copyright © 2012 Apache Software Foundation. All Rights Reserved.